David Letterman Retirement Date: When the Legend Signed Off

David Letterman officially ended his long television career on May 20, 2015, concluding decades of late-night hosting and shaping modern comedy. His retirement date marked a turning point for American talk shows, leaving behind a legacy of sharp satire and iconic Top Ten lists.

Event Date Network Significance
Late Night with David Letterman debut February 1, 1982 NBC Launched his countercultural style and loyal audience
Move to The Late Show August 30, 1993 CBS Shifted to a larger platform and more mainstream appeal
Final episode announcement February 1, 2014 CBS Letterman revealed plans to retire in 2015
Retirement date May 20, 2015 CBS Farewell broadcast with historic guests and reflections

When exactly did David Letterman retire from late-night television?

David Letterman's retirement date was May 20, 2015, when he aired his final episode of The Late Show on CBS.

Did he give much advance notice before his retirement date?

He announced his plan to retire in February 2014, providing about a year of notice before the official retirement date.
